Family and friends of Daisy Washington, who died in a car crash when she was 14, are gearing up for a charity golf day and fete in her memory.

Both will take place at Homelands golf club, Ashford Road, Kingsnorth, this Saturday.

Since Daisy died on February 28, 2007, her parents Karen and Joe Washington and family friends, particularly Alison Lang, have worked tirelessly raising thousands of pounds for local charities.

They have persuaded stars to donate autographed items for a charity auction, including a David Beckham shirt, a football signed by this season’s Manchester United team, a Millwall football, a Frank Lampard kit, a Steven Gerrard Liverpool shirt, a Crystal Palace shirt, a cricket bat signed by the Surrey county cricket team and a Kylie Minogue CD.

Ex-Liverpool and England footballer Neil 'Razor’ Ruddock will be playing in the charity golf match and ex-Everton and Wales footballer Neville Southall and former boxer Johnny Armour will be attending an evening event.

A fire engine is one of many attractions at the fete in aid of the Pilgrim’s Hospice, which runs from 10am to 2pm in the golf club car park.
